Surge Energy Inc. (TSE:SGY - Get Free Report) rose 2% on Tuesday . The stock traded as high as C$7.64 and last traded at C$7.55. Approximately 310,493 shares were traded during mid-day trading, a decline of 45% from the average daily volume of 562,234 shares. The stock had previously closed at C$7.40.

Wall Street Analysts Forecast Growth

SGY has been the subject of several analyst reports. ATB Capital raised their price objective on Surge Energy from C$7.50 to C$8.25 and gave the company an "outperform" rating in a report on Tuesday. Roth Capital set a C$8.50 price objective on Surge Energy and gave the company a "buy" rating in a report on Monday, July 14th. Finally, Raymond James Financial raised their price objective on Surge Energy from C$8.00 to C$9.00 and gave the company an "outperform" rating in a report on Tuesday. Three investment analysts have rated the stock with a buy rating and two have issued a strong buy rating to the company's stock. According to data from MarketBeat, Surge Energy has a consensus rating of "Buy" and an average price target of C$9.89.

Surge Energy Price Performance

The company has a quick ratio of 0.40, a current ratio of 0.66 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 31.48. The firm has a market cap of C$761.26 million, a P/E ratio of -9.49, a PEG ratio of 0.59 and a beta of 2.54. The business has a fifty day moving average of C$6.25 and a 200 day moving average of C$5.69.

Surge Energy Dividend Announcement

The business also recently disclosed a monthly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, August 15th. Shareholders of record on Friday, August 15th will be given a dividend of $0.0433 per share.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, July 31st. This represents a $0.52 annualized dividend and a yield of 6.86%. Surge Energy's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ently -65.21%.

Insider Activity at Surge Energy

In other Surge Energy news, Director Allison Michelle Maher sold 13,100 shares of the firm's st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, July 30th. The shares were sold at an average price of C$7.64, for a total transaction of C$100,070.90. Also, Senior Officer Murray Bye acquired 11,845 shares of the business's stock in a transaction on Friday, May 9th. The shares were bought at an average price of C$4.88 per share, with a total value of C$57,803.60. Company insiders own 1.97% of the company's stock.

About Surge Energy

(Get Free Report)

Surge Energy Inc is engaged in the exploration, development, and production of oil and gas from properties in western Canada. The company generates its revenue from the sale of petroleum and natural gas products such as Oil, Natural gas liquids and Natural gas, of which a majority of the revenue is derived from the sale of oil.
